    Orange triad and mega thirst/dehydration

    Since starting orange triad about 1 week ago, I get incredibly thirsty for about 3-4 hours after taking it. If I don't drink an absolutely insane amount in this time, I feel like I will pass out (srs)


    Now I know that on the tub, it actually says consume at least 1 GOWAD, and goes into detail about how it is imperative that you drink this much and don't have a history of dehydration or whatnot


    What I want to know is WHY. Why is it imperative that you drink so much, and what is actually in orange triad that necessitates this massive requirement?


    I used to take animal pak religiously, and although that also claimed you needed to drink a ton of water, I didn't notice any effects if I didn't

    Whats different about triad?

    An extrmely short review btw: I feel better (provided I drink a hell of a lot) on triad than animal pak. No bias

    I dont believe the OT is significantly dehydrating him in any way

    There are many more probable causes: more sweating, more sodium in the diet, other things he hasnt accounted for.
